Who is Anna Wintour?
Anna Wintour is a prominent figure in the fashion world, best known as the editor-in-chief of Vogue magazine since 1988. Her influence on fashion is unparalleled, as she has shaped trends and launched the careers of numerous designers. With her signature bob haircut and oversized sunglasses, Wintour has become a cultural icon, often regarded as the most powerful woman in fashion. Her career spans decades, and her leadership at Vogue has solidified her status as a leading authority in the industry.

Anna Wintour's Net Worth
As of 2023, Anna Wintour's net worth is estimated to be around $50 million. This wealth is attributed to her long-standing career at Vogue, as well as various other ventures, including her involvement in fashion events such as the Met Gala. Her salary as editor-in-chief is substantial, and she has also earned money through book deals and public speaking engagements.
